body{
font-family:Arial;
background:#eee;
}

#results{
display:flex;
flex-wrap:wrap;
gap:10px;
}

.card{
width:180px;
background:white;
padding:5px;
border:1px solid #999;
}

img,video{
max-width:100%;
}

audio{
width:100%;
}
